Transaction 8304d55e714beddf59e123adc23de1f63e55f5cf1b06a538f43a1cff347edf29
1 Input
1 Output
-
8304d55e714beddf59e123adc23de1f63e55f5cf1b06a538f43a1cff347edf29:0
- value
- 2121278
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66bd44970895c39cd8d0e1cf619c32c1bbcca03c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ANEf8iQ2cVb1p1urj2vmnWyVcT956bX97